The Kabbalah Centre International is a non-profit organization for spiritual connection, guidance, and education headquartered in Los Angeles, California, that provides courses on the Zohar and Kabbalistic teachings online as well as through its regional and city-based centres and study groups worldwide. The modern-day, universal presentation of Kabbalah was developed by its leader, Philip Berg (a traditionally trained orthodox rabbi who had left the religious clergy, went into the insurance business, and then focused his life on learning and sharing Kabbalah with the world) along with his wife...

Receive stars from at least ten different users for at least 10 different messages in chat
Each message is only counted once, and each user is only counted once. So it's not enough if one message is starred by nine people, and a tenth user stars nine other messages.
If you want to know, here's the precise definition: Consider the bipartite graph whose vertices are all your messages and all the users, and whose edges are the stars you received. So a user (vertex) and a message (vertex) are connected by an edge if and only if the given user has starred the given message. You are eligible for
